NOVELTY - Molding of magnetotherapy mattress involves adding 40-50 parts mass natural latex and 1-3 parts mass graphene to 1-2 parts mass foaming agent to foam, stirring and mixing 25-40 parts mass polyolefin, 2-9 parts mass carbon fibers, 0.5-2 part mass surfactant, 1.5-3 parts mass foam stabilizer, and 0.5-1 part mass catalyst to the foam mixture in sequence at a stirring rate of 450-650 rpm for 30-50 minutes to obtain a mixed liquid, adding 10-12 parts mass toluene diisocyanate, stirring and mixing, maintaining still for reaction foaming to obtain a foamed mattress, placing a magnet in the mold cavity, passing the foamed mattress through a hose and transporting to the mold, filling the mold to the top with the foamed mattress and closing the mold, gelling or solidifying the foam under the action of a gelling agent so that the magnet and foam are solidified to obtain a magnetotherapy mattress mold, curing the mold in a steam room, and removing the mattress from the mold, washing and drying. USE - Molding of magnetotherapy mattress. ADVANTAGE - The method produces magnetotherapy mattress which is convenient to use and has excellent wear resistance and long service life, by one-step and simple process.
